      Senior Analyst Interview

      Nov 10, 2014
      Anonymous employee
      Framingham, MA
      Accepted offer
      Positive experience
      Average interview

      Application

      I applied online. The process took 3 weeks. I interviewed at Staples (Framingham, MA) in Jun 2012

      Interview

      I initially applied online back in late May 2012. A week later I was contacted via email by an HR rep and we scheduled an hour to talk over the phone. The phone interview was not difficult, as there were basic behavioral and experience questions. Basically they are looking to see if you are really qualified and if you "really" are interested in the job. I was then given a date to have an in -person interview at the home office with the hiring manager and another manager in the same group. That whole process took one hour, which I felt was really not enough time. The hiring manager spent most of the 30 minutes talking about the job and did not really ask me much about my background or what I thought, though he was extremely informative. the second manager asked more behavioral questions and questions geared around seeing why I was leaving my current job. I was called back the following week to meet with the Director of the department. This was the hardest part of the whole process, as she really dug into what I had done in my current and prior jobs, as well as how they could relate to this job. We talked a lot about the department and where it was heading, as well as what they were hoping to accomplish for the next few years. I was made an offer two days later, and after a couple back and forths I accepted their offer.

      Application

      I applied online. The process took 4 weeks. I interviewed at Staples (Boston, MA) in Oct 2023

      Interview

      The interview process spanned over a month. After the final interview with Staples, I got an offer from another company. So, I told Staples recruiter to expedite the process. Unfortunately, they didn't speed up and I accepted the other company's offer. Staples's offer came 1 week after starting my new job. This company does not know how to recruit people. If you cannot make a decision after 1 month and 6 rounds of interviews, then you are doing something wrong. Also, Staples is a dying company, their revenue has been falling since 2012.
